How We Got Started

Established in 1979, Transworld Business Advisors was originally founded in South Florida by Don (a 30 year IBM executive) and his wife Bonnie Parrish. It quickly grew to the largest business brokerage in the U.S.

Although the company was thriving, CEO Andrew Cagnetta envisioned even more growth. It wasn’t long before United Franchise Group CEO Ray Titus and Cagnetta teamed up to form a partnership and offer Transworld Business Advisors as a franchise.

With over 30 years in franchising, Ray provided the leadership under United Franchise Group, which is home to award winning franchises such as Signarama, Fully Promoted (formally EmbroidMe), Experimac, SuperGreen Solutions, VentureX, and Jon Smith Subs. Andy provided the business brokerage industry experience. Their symbiotic relationship helped grow the Transworld franchise into more than 220 franchisees around the world.

Transworld Business Advisors is headquartered in West Palm Beach, Florida.

Lauren from Business Advisor, Transworld Business Advisors TN RE License 371471 GA RE License 432772 Answered this on September 05, 2019

(more) I once had a suggestion box that staff could anonymously contribute to.  But that never worked.  We also held "Same Page Meetings" where attendees could make suggestions based on the topic of discussion.  If they even approached me with an idea, I thanked them and listened to see if it had merit. Ideally, their suggestion should be substantiated before moving ahead.  If it's in the brainstorming end, I believe one of the best ways would be to task that employee with the project or partnering with another team member to see if it's do-able.  If it is a suggestion which could be implemented based on budget and time constraints (aka profit margin), they would be recognized and even rewarded.
